Diferencia entre revisiones de «Comando Extrae»

De GeoGebra Manual
Saltar a: navegación, buscar
m (())
 
(No se muestran 30 ediciones intermedias de 4 usuarios)
Línea 1: Línea 1:
<noinclude>{{Manual Page|version=4.0}}</noinclude>{{Comandos Específicos CAS (Cálculo Avanzado)|cas=true|list|Extrae}}
+
<noinclude>{{Manual Page|version=5.0}}
;Extrae[ <Texto> o <Lista>, <Posición Inicial>, <Posición Final> ]:Da por resultado el texto o la lista que contiene los elementos del o de la original, desde el que ocupa la posición inicial al de la final.
+
 
:{{Example| 1=<br>
+
</noinclude>{{command|cas=true|list|Extrae}}
:*  <code><nowiki>Extrae["Con aquellos perros de la playa lejana", 10, 31]</nowiki></code> expone en la [[Vista Gráfica]],  '''''los perros de la playa'''''.
+
;Extrae( <Lista>, <Posición inicial> )
:* <code><nowiki>Extrae["GeoGebra", 3, 6]</nowiki></code> da por resultado  el texto ''oGeb''.
+
:Crea la lista de los elementos desde de la ''posición inicial'' hasta el final de la lista dada.
:* Siendo ''Li'' una lista, de <code><nowiki>'''Extrae'''[Li, m, n]</nowiki></code> resulta otra con los elementos que en ''Li'' ocupan desde la posición ''m'' a la ''n''.
+
:{{example| 1=<div><code><nowiki>Extrae({2, 4, 3, 7, 4}, 3)</nowiki></code> devuelve ''{3, 7, 4}''.</div>}}
:* <code><nowiki>Extrae[ {2, 4, 3, 7, 4}, 3, 4]</nowiki></code> da por resultado ''{3, 7}''.}}
+
; Extrae( <Texto>, <Posición inicial> )
{{betamanual|version=4.2|Desde GG 4.2, se suman sendas sintaxis:
+
:Devuelve un texto que contiene los caracteres desde la ''posición inicial'' hasta el final del texto dado.
;Extrae[ <Lista>, <Posición Inicial m> ]
+
:{{example| 1=<div><code><nowiki> Extrae("GeoGebra", 3)</nowiki></code> devuelve el texto ''oGebra''.</div>}}
;Extrae[ <Texto>, <Posición Inicial m> ]:Da por resultado una lista o texto con los elementos de la o del original, desde la posición ''m'', hasta el final.
+
; Extrae( <Lista>, <Posición inicial>, <Posición final> )
{{example| 1=<br>
+
:Crea la lista de los elementos desde de la ''posición inicial'' hasta la ''posición final'' de la lista dada.
* <code><nowiki>Extrae[{2, 4, 3, 7, 4}, 3]</nowiki></code> da por resultado '''''{3, 7, 4}'''''.
+
:{{example| 1=<div><code><nowiki> Extrae({2, 4, 3, 7, 4}, 3, 4)</nowiki></code> devuelve ''{3, 7}''.</div>}}
* <code><nowiki>Extrae["GeoGebra", 3]</nowiki></code> da por resultado el texto '''''oGebra'''''}}
+
; Extrae( <Texto>, <Posición inicial>, <Posición final> )
}}
+
:Devuelve un texto que contiene los caracteres desde la ''posición inicial'' hasta la ''posición final'' del texto dado.
== Sintaxis en Vista CAS ==
+
:{{example| 1=<div><code><nowiki> Extrae("GeoGebra", 3, 6)</nowiki></code> devuelve el texto ''oGeb''.</div>}}
La variante disponible en la [[Vista Algebraica CAS|Vista CAS]], es la que opera  con una lista.
+
 
{{Example| 1=<br><code><nowiki>Extrae[{1, 2, a, 4, 5}, 2, 4]</nowiki></code> da ''{2, a, 4}''.}}
+
 
{{hint|1= El valor de la posición inicial debe ser menor, o igual, que el de la final (''m'' ≥ ''n'').}}
+
{{Note| 1= En la {{vista|cas}} funciona únicamente para listas.}}

Revisión actual del 00:26 26 ago 2020



Extrae( <Lista>, <Posición inicial> )
Crea la lista de los elementos desde de la posición inicial hasta el final de la lista dada.
Ejemplo:
Extrae({2, 4, 3, 7, 4}, 3) devuelve {3, 7, 4}.
Extrae( <Texto>, <Posición inicial> )
Devuelve un texto que contiene los caracteres desde la posición inicial hasta el final del texto dado.
Ejemplo:
Extrae("GeoGebra", 3) devuelve el texto oGebra.
Extrae( <Lista>, <Posición inicial>, <Posición final> )
Crea la lista de los elementos desde de la posición inicial hasta la posición final de la lista dada.
Ejemplo:
Extrae({2, 4, 3, 7, 4}, 3, 4) devuelve {3, 7}.
Extrae( <Texto>, <Posición inicial>, <Posición final> )
Devuelve un texto que contiene los caracteres desde la posición inicial hasta la posición final del texto dado.
Ejemplo:
Extrae("GeoGebra", 3, 6) devuelve el texto oGeb.


Nota: En la Menu view cas.svg Vista CAS funciona únicamente para listas.
© 2024 International GeoGebra Institute